Questions & Answers
Q: Why is balance sheet strength important in value investing?
Balance sheet strength provides a foundation for stability and resilience during market downturns, allowing companies to continue performing well and creating value for investors. It ensures that a company has sufficient assets to cover its liabilities and a healthy financial position.
Q: How does a quantitative approach to value investing differ from a discretionary approach?
A quantitative approach relies on statistical measures and systematic decision-making, which helps investors stay disciplined and consistent in their investment strategy. It ensures that decisions are based on objective data rather than subjective judgment, minimizing emotional biases and maximizing long-term success.
Q: Has value investing underperformed in recent years?
While value investing has experienced periods of underperformance, historical data shows that value stocks have consistently outperformed growth stocks over the long term. However, recent years have seen a relative weakness in value investing, partly due to changes in balance sheet compositions and the use of specific value metrics.
Q: How can value investors navigate market volatility and downturns?
Value investors can mitigate the impact of market volatility by maintaining a long-short strategy, capturing potential outperformance during downturns and fully investing when the market starts to recover. By focusing on balance sheet strength, quantitative metrics, and disciplined decision-making, value investors can navigate turbulent times and achieve successful outcomes.
